Nintendo DS Browser Does not support:
Flash
Animated Picture File (MAY be Movie Files -makes more sense-)
Audio Files
PDF File
In addition to anything else that needs plugins (aka Shockwave, Java, etc.)

Edit: Also, the RAM expansion is necessary they say. Whether it won't start without it or webpages just load very very bad to the point of being unreadable they didn't say.

Also, the Parent Protection is just a proxy you set up in the DS Browser Options (yes it supports proxies), you can also password protect the browser so the child can't just turn it on and go, they have to ask the parent to input the password. I don't know how the proxy settings are protected, I'd just turn the proxy off to bypass the restrictions.
